Mom of two killed in freak accident as plane making emergency landing hits her car

A devoted mom of two was killed in front of her daughter by a small plane that landed on her car while making an emergency landing on a highway.Alex Garneau and her daughter were in one of four cars hit by the twin-engine Beech King Air 200 plane as it landed in Prince George, British Columbia, on Thursday afternoon.“It was absolutely unbelievable,” one of the other drivers, Jaime Pawliuk, told CBC of the plane shattering his sunroof.

“It’s something you only see in movies.”The pilot was forced to make the emergency landing when one of its engines lost power before he could safely make it the final 13 miles to Prince George airport.None of the six passengers nor two crew on the twin-engine plane operated by Sekani Air were injured.But Garneau was “driving with her daughter Josie when the plane impacted with their vehicle and she was tragically killed,” a family friend said on Facebook.Josie walked away “most unharmed” from the crash site, the friend said.

Garneua was a proud “hockey mom” whose two kids — Josie and son Jackson — both play.She also leaves behind husband Jordan.“She was the kind of person who was behind the scenes of almost every team and activity her kids were part of.
